Fusion is my jam, besides the obvious like Takanaka or Herbie Hancock, I recommend: Weather Report (specially Heavy Weather, I also love This is This and Black Market) Stanley Clarke (songs like Lopsy Lu, School Days or Silly Putty) Chick Corea (The Leprechaun, songs like Lenore and Night Sprite) and his other bands too. Jaco Pastorius. His other work besides Weather Report is excellent (start with the song Chicken and spread out from there) I have a fusion playlist with tons of this stuff on spotify with a bit of everything (some Herbie Mann, Fela Kuti, 80's Miles Davis, John Scofield, etc) if you like these you can DM me for the link! Oh man I love this album to unhealthy amounts, and Casiopea in general. This album has a really unique sound and it's a bit hard to find something exactly alike it. But some albums I did end up enjoying (in the sphere of Jaoanese Fusion ofc) were For Lovers by Lamp (listen to the song Last Train at 25 o clockfirst), Ryo Kawasaki - Mirror to My Mind (listen to the track it was named after first) and Masayoshi Takanaka - The Rainbow Goblins as well as more Jazzy City Pop albums like Sunshower by Taeko Ohnuki.
